Sun Carnival Basketball Tournament in 1961 - Newspaper Article

The picture shows the newspaper article by the Herald Post which highlights the win of the Miners in the Sun Carnival Basketball Tournament on December 28-29, 1961. The four-team tournament featured teams of University of New Mexico, New Mexico State University, Baylor, and the host Texas Western (now UTEP). Texas Western won the tournament against the University of New Mexico 73-53. In 1966 the team of head coach Don Haskins would make history by winning the 1966 NCAA Men's Division I Basketball Tournament. For that game, Haskins lined up an all-black team, which defeated the favored Kentucky Wildcats (a team that was all-white) 72-65 in the historic championship game, played at Cole Field House in College Park, Maryland on March 19, 1966. No major-college team had ever started five black players in an NCAA championship game, which is why this game is considered one of the most important ones in the history of college basketball.
